OP here. Catcher in the Rye is pretty different from most novels I've read, in that the protagonist seemingly just whines generally the entire time. There's not much of a build up and it ends rather abruptly. However, because it's different from the norm in those ways, I liked it.

>>675611226
It's a post-apocalyptic novel about an abbey dedicated to preserving pre-war knowledge. The story span hundreds of years.
